Output de703f0ba3c6509b509c3a38e68ade0ff3b11337535979ae74ecb6ef99f5207b:9

value
43984807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 140d237649a61253d6ea700cc67f9e9c92840b8b OP_EQUAL
address
33X3BG6EAMsgToAsDdQUZqYB7Rb9b5VJ41
transaction
de703f0ba3c6509b509c3a38e68ade0ff3b11337535979ae74ecb6ef99f5207b
confirmations
473163
spent
true